Once an individual comes to terms with the truth that they need help to resolve drug addiction, the next action is deciding upon the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ug rehabilitation programs don't call for any form of inpatient stay and supply services on an outpatient basis for instance. At this type of drug rehab the individual gets treatment during the day and returns home in the evening. While this form of drug rehab may appear convenient, it will not present the appropriate treatment environment for a person who desires to step away from drug influences and other situations which could compromise one's sobriety. The most proven and helpful treatment settings are those which call for an inpatient or residential stay, so that the person can concentrate ent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day distractions and drug addiction triggers.
For instance, somebody or some situation in one's environment could be the precise trigger of one's drug use. If the individual returns to this every day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will usually relapse. There are also various l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ug rehabilitation programs, with treatment curriculums ranging from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, someone who is intent on fixing addiction issues once and for all should remain in drug rehab as long as it requires. A month in treatment is rarely enough time to even recuperate physically from continual substance abuse. A significant amount of time is essential, even months in some cases,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al psychologically and emotionally so that one can truly make a clean start once treatment is complete.
The expense of drug rehab can vary considerably of course, depending on the facilities offered, length of stay, etc. While cost should never be an obstacle to getting life-saving treatment in drug rehab, it is a logistic that some may have concern over. After all, addiction is likely to exhaust all assets and it can be tough to pay for drug rehab when the time comes. Luckily, most private drug treatment programs accept many types of private health insurance as well as Medicare and Medicaid. Some drug rehabilitation programs will even work with people to either supply payment assistance or offer a sliding fee scale based off of one's earnings and individual circumstances. Addicted people and their families will find that treatment counselors are more than prepared to help present solutions and support to get the logistical and financial problems resolved so that these are not a barrier to getting the individuals started in drug rehab.
